I have a Tab 2 GT-P5110 - stuck in a boot loop. Very occasionally I can get it up for maybe just long enough to check the odd setting, but not let me do anything meaningful, then it reboots.
I have cleared flash using the boot options. I have noticed that when going there it often comes up with an error about the cache.
Downloaded Odin 3.13, downloaded firmware P5110XXDNH2_P5110OXADNH2_HOME.tar.md5 (which I believe is the latest UK version for the model), used the "standard" Odin settings - and the bar in the Program gets about 40% across the block at the top, then fails.

Are there any other options I can try, have I missed something obvious, or is it to all intents and purposes dead?

I'm not seeing anything out of whack in your settings. But before declaring this thing dead, try plugging the ROM into the BL slot and flashing it.

You've done all you can here; it certainly appears that the flash storage is stuck in a read-only state. That's a fancy way of saying the tablet's dead. I would contact Samsung and explain the situation, though I would leave out mention of using Odin, and see what they suggest.
